This position is part of the global cybersecurity organization with primary responsibility in the area of Allegion’s connected products and services. The successful candidate will work collaboratively and cross‑functionally with product development teams and mobile software teams to ensure a high standard of quality, security, and data privacy across the full lifecycle of Allegion’s products and services. The Lead Security Mobile Engineer will have strong ownership to ensure Allegion’s systems are reliable, scalable, high‑performing, economical, and secure. The position reports to the Director of Global Product Cybersecurity.

What You Will Do
  • Serve as product security point of contact for software and product development teams across the enterprise including matters related to data privacy, devices, cloud, API, and application security.
  • Partner with engineering teams to embed security and privacy into the software development lifecycle through architecture reviews, security requirements, secure coding practices, and automated security controls.
  • Coach and mentor engineers throughout Allegion’s global product engineering and software operations on security tools, risk management, and balancing application of security against business needs and risks.
  • Contribute to concepts, design, deployment, and lifecycle management related to Allegion’s global product engineering and software operations.
  • Promote the implementation of standard security architecture conventions to ensure the availability, performance, scalability and security of Allegion’s mobile applications, mobile SDKs, and connected products.
  • Participate in solution assessments across the solution lifecycle: concept, design, pre‑deployment, post‑deployment, end of life. This may involve testing inclusive of ethical hacking.
  • Provide guidance to third‑party‑managed product installations globally through the specification of requirements and validation of operations.
  • Contribute to the execution of security operations inclusive of threat modeling, monitoring and incident response across mobile applications, APIs, cloud services, and connected devices.
  • Keep up with the latest security threats, attack vectors, mobile technologies, cloud computing technologies, embedded processing technologies, and associated security controls to ensure the security ecosystem is well‑architected to address key risks.
  • Participate in technology and security architecture reviews and serve as a trusted advisor to global software and product development teams on architecture and control design.
  • Protect the company from a wide‑variety of business risks ranging from financial loss, regulatory fines and penalties, loss of intellectual property, and/or brand/reputation risk.
  • Approximately 15% travel may be expected.
  • Work location is variable with onsite, hybrid, or remote options.
What You Need To Succeed
  • 8+ years of mobile software development experience. At least two to five years as a demonstrated security practitioner leading a security strategy across multiple products.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ills required to influence and partner with all levels across the enterprise on matters of product development, software development and cloud deployment/operations including risk mitigations.
  • High degree of learning agility required to quickly gain visibility across Allegion’s global software and product portfolio.
  • Highly technical product security practitioner with working knowledge of delivering secure mobile applications, IoT products and services globally using modern technologies.
  • College deg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Systems, Cybersecurity or equivalent education/experience required. Related industry certifications are preferred.
  • Preferred candidates will have experience delivering results successfully in a diverse, global, and fast‑paced environment.
